Claims (2)
- フライホイールの外周にテコの原理を利用する為ギアの設置を有する、ギア付フライホイール(1)のギアとギア付高回転小電力モータ(4)のギアを噛み合わせる、ギア付フライホイール(1)の目標設定回転数まで発電機(3)とギア付高回転小電力モータ(4)で外部電力を入力してギア付フライホイール(1)を目標設定回転数にする、ギア付フライホイール(1)が目標設定回転数に到達時には発電機(3)の外部電力の入力を切りコンバーター(6)を介してバッテリー(5)に充電する、ギア付フライホイール(1)の回転を止める事無く設定回転数維持しで回転し続けます
- ギア付フライホイール(1)は設定回転数維持しで回転し続けますのでギア付フライホイール(1)と発電機(3)の間にクラッチ付変速機(2)で発電機(3)に入力する回転数を制御します
